Distribution and wholesale businesses run on thin margins and high volumes. Small forecasting errors create excess stock or missed sales. In 2026, manual spreadsheets cannot handle multi-warehouse inventory, vendor lead times, and fluctuating demand. A modern ERP platform connects sales, inventory, finance, and procurement into one real-time system.

In 2026, demand patterns change faster due to online channels, regional pricing shifts, and supplier instability. Traditional ERP systems focus on accounting, not predictive demand. A distribution-focused SaaS ERP platform analyzes sales history, seasonality, and customer trends to generate accurate forecasts automatically.
Our platform uses real-time sales data to suggest reorder quantities based on safety stock, minimum order quantity, and supplier lead time. Managers see projected stock-outs weeks in advance. This prevents emergency purchases and improves negotiation power with vendors. The result is controlled purchasing and stronger working capital management.
Most wholesalers struggle with overstocked slow-moving items and frequent stock-outs of fast-moving goods. Buyers often rely on experience instead of data. Vendor pricing changes are not updated in time. Purchase approvals are delayed. These gaps reduce margins and create unnecessary borrowing.
Another major issue is disconnected systems. Sales teams promise delivery without checking real inventory. Finance teams do not see committed purchase orders. Warehouse teams update stock manually at the end of the day. Our ERP platform removes these silos and connects procurement decisions directly to live operational data.
